The hexadecimal color code #331DDF corresponds to the code RGB( 51, 29, 223 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,20 level), green (at 0,11 level) and blue (at 0,87 level). Its brightness is 49% and its saturation is 76%. It is composed of red at 16%, green at 9% and blue at 73%. The dominant component is blue.

Uses of #331DDF in CSS

When using #331DDF as the background color, consider selecting a lighter text color for improved readability. If you want to use #331DDF as the text color, prefer a light background, such as Blanc.
